Seaside Osieki
BackNadmorski Osieki is a holiday resort located at 18 Nadmorska Street in Osieki, offering accommodation in wooden summer cottages. The facility positions itself as a friendly place for families with children and those seeking a peaceful holiday surrounded by nature, overlooking Lake Jamno. However, an analysis of available information and guest reviews paints a complex picture of this place, with clearly marked advantages and disadvantages that potential guests should carefully consider before booking.
Characteristics of the facility and accommodation
The resort consists of several detached wooden cottages of varying sizes, designed for 2, 4, or 6 people. Both single-story and two-story structures are available, with areas ranging from 24 m² to 48 m². The cottages boast an aesthetically pleasing exterior, and the entire property is fenced, providing a sense of security, especially important for families with small children. Free parking is available on-site. It's worth noting that at least some of the cottages are accessible to people with disabilities, a significant advantage.
Equipment and standard of the cottages
The issue of amenities is one of the most polarizing aspects of a stay at Nadmorski Osieki. On the one hand, the property's official website and some booking portals report standard amenities such as an LCD TV, refrigerator with freezer, two-burner hob, kettle, and a basic set of dishes and cutlery. Each cottage-style holiday apartment also features a terrace with garden furniture and a clothes dryer. Furthermore, guests praise the availability of heaters, which proved invaluable on cold, rainy days.
On the other hand, numerous guest reviews point to the kitchen's very minimal, if not inadequate, equipment. Some complain about the lack of basic cooking utensils, such as more pots (sometimes only one is available), a frying pan, a sharp bread knife, or a colander. For families planning to prepare meals themselves, this can be a significant inconvenience, requiring them to bring their own equipment. There's also a lack of such small items as a laundry bowl or beach screens, which are often standard in seaside resorts. These inconveniences contrast with the "luxurious" description used in the property's promotional materials.
Location – the biggest controversy
The facility's location is both its greatest asset and its greatest drawback, depending on guest expectations and the interpretation of marketing materials. The resort is indeed very close to Lake Jamno (approximately 20 meters), which may be attractive to anglers and those who appreciate water views. However, guest reviews suggest that the lakeshore in this area is overgrown and difficult to access, and the lack of a pier prevents full enjoyment of its charms.
Access to the sea
The distance to the sea is the most confusing. The website and various offers often include information such as "10 minutes from the sea" or "1,000 meters from the sea." Some guests find these statements highly misleading. Reports indicate that reaching the beach on foot takes nearly an hour. The nearest beach is in Łazy, which is about 5 km away by car (nearly 10 minutes), and then, after parking in a paid parking lot, a short walk through the forest. This is crucial information for those choosing accommodation with daily, walking access to the beach in mind. This is definitely not your typical guesthouse or hotel located right next to a dune. For tourists with cars, this location can be an advantage – it serves as a good base for exploring Mielno, Koszalin, Kołobrzeg, or Darłowo.
Attractions in and around the resort
The seaside resort of Osieki makes up for its location with family-friendly amenities. The property features a playground with a trampoline, swings, and a slide, as well as a volleyball court. The owners provide barbecue facilities and a dedicated bonfire area, which facilitates socializing and evening relaxation. These amenities are highly rated by families with children, who find a safe space to play here.
In the immediate vicinity, in Osieki itself, you can visit a 14th-century Gothic church. The proximity of Łazy and Mielno opens up access to a wider range of tourist infrastructure, restaurants, and shops, though again, this requires a car. Peace and quiet, especially at night and in the off-season, are often highlighted as a true respite from the hustle and bustle of the city.

Summary: who is Nadmorski Osieki for?
By analyzing all aspects, you can create a profile of the ideal guest for this property. Seaside Osieki is a good hospedaje for families with children who have their own cars and don't expect luxury, but value peace, safety, and on-site attractions for children. It's also a good choice for those who use their accommodation as a base for exploring the region and are willing to commute daily to the beach or other towns.
However, this is definitely not a recommended resort for those without a car, who prefer proximity to the beach and sea. Tourists expecting a well-equipped kitchen for self-catering and easy access to the lake may also be disappointed. Before booking, it's crucial to understand the actual distance from the sea and accept that daily trips to the beach will require a short car ride. Despite some drawbacks, the clean, cottage-style rooms , friendly service, and child-friendly amenities make this a successful holiday destination for the right target group.
